de spektakulära stora pyramiderna i Giza och den mystiska sfinksen. Dessa gamla underverk har byggts av miljoner block av kalksten och har stått i nästan 5000 år och är bland de första stenbyggnaderna som någonsin dykt upp på denna planet. När du utforskar platån i Giza kommer din expertguide att hjälpa till att leva den fantastiska historien levande och du kommer också att få den valfria chansen att komma in i Great Pyramid of Cheops eller en av de mindre pyramiderna.
mystisk sfinks. Konstruerad från ett stenblock
det egyptiska museet för antikviteter för att se världens största samling av egyptiska föremål inklusive det legendariska draget från Tutankhamuns grav. Över 120 000 föremål visas på skärmen inklusive enorma statyer av faraonerna och gudarna som de dyrkade, juveler, pappersrullar, kistor inlagda med halvädelstenar och forntida mumifierade rester. Även om det skulle ta månader att beundra varje relik, hjälper din expertguide dig att upptäcka några av de mest kända föremålen, inklusive Tuthankhamuns världsberömda massiva guldbegravningsmask.

For weeks before our trip, I was looking all over Tripadvisor for a one-day trip to Cairo from Hurghada by plane, to see Giza and the museum (only). However, all of the reviews I could find were from other people who complained about guides who would spend very little time at the pyramids/museum but then rush them to the bazaar, where they complained about being encouraged to buy souvenirs. This was not what we wanted, and we wanted a historical tour on just Giza and the museum. So I’m very pleased to say that we found exactly what we wanted (and more) with Gouda. He was very friendly and incredibly knowledgeable about the history of Cairo. The whole drive from the airport to the pyramids, he was teaching us the stories of ancient Egypt and was very engaging with his communication. Three days before our arrival in Egypt, we had excellent confirmations via WhatsApp regarding all of our flight and transfers, and the night before our flight, Gouda contacted us to confirm where he would meet us at the airport. Gouda went out his way to make sure we got the maximum out of the tour. By arranging us to be at the pyramids by 08:30, when there would be less people. He also knew the best photo opportunity spots and was happy to tweak the tour around what was important to us. His wealth of knowledge was excellent and we learned so much from him. Once we had finished at the pyramids and Sphinx, he asked us what would be more important for our lunch, if we wanted an expensive restaurant with a view of Giza, or if we wanted a more local restaurant with great food. We went with the second choice and had one of the best chicken shawarma we’ve ever had, with the cost for 2 people being around £10 (GBP) in total! With the extra time we saved by being early at the pyramids. He offered an optional stop at a papyrus and oil shop, there was no obligation to buy anything and the shop owners were not at all pushy with selling either. We were given free drinks and a relaxing explanation of how papyrus is made and how perfume and oils were created. Some users on trustpilot complained about other tour companies forcing them to visit these places and spending over an hour waiting to leave. With Gouda, he made it clear that this stop was optional, he explained that we didn’t have to buy anything or feel pressured; and he also took us here as they offered the cleanest toilets for free (which can’t be said at the pyramids themselves!). As soon as we were no longer interested, we had to signal to Gouda and he instantly took us back to the car without any pushy selling. Because of this, these visits were a pleasant surprise and interesting. At the museum, Gouda was in his element. He clearly was an expert and knew where the best exhibitions were. He took us around the key parts of the museum first and then gave us our own free time to explore while he waited by the exit before taking us back to the airport. I cannot recommend this trip enough.
